    Hi all, I'm currently ripping a whole bunch of CDs for use with Jellyfin. After the ripping is done I am using Musicbrainz Picard to automatically scan the titles for the correct album and give them their correct metadata. Usually this works quite well, however I've now had an issue with the Album Cover multiple times and I can't seem to get it fixed:

    Picard usually includes an image as a cover art and when playing files that have been ran through Picard they show up (i.e. in Windows Media Player)      .
    Also when playing these Songs from Jellyfin they also show up in the bottom left corner     
    But when looking at the album (either in the list of albums or when expanding it to see all songs) this image is nowhere to be seen      .

    I've already refreshed the metadata from within Jellyfin but the coverart did not change. I find it quite odd that this only happens on some albums and not others. Is there some Metadata setting that I am missing?

    There is not. One more thing that I just now noticed. I believe this issue only happens with albums that have multiple Discs to them. I don't believe I ever saw this issue on single CD albums

    I've since found out that the folder structure for Music seems to have changed. Before you were supposed to have seperate folders for each CD, however now you can just place all Songs into the Album's folder and the images then work.
